The Ausangate Trek is one of the most breathtaking hikes in the Peruvian Andes, combining glacier landscapes, colorful lagoons, snow-capped peaks, and high-Andean communities that preserve their ancestral traditions. Over 4 days, you’ll hike along trails surrounded by the majestic Ausangate Mountain (6,384 m / 20,945 ft), relax in natural hot springs, and finish with a visit to the world-famous Rainbow Mountain (Vinicunca) — one of Peru’s most iconic destinations.




DAY 1: CUSCO – TINKI – UPIS
Early departure from Cusco towards Tinki, a small Andean village where our trek begins. We’ll hike to Upis (4,400 m / 14,436 ft), enjoying views of Ausangate along the way. In the afternoon, you can relax in the hot springs before dinner and camping overnight.
DAY 2: UPIS – ARAPA PASS – PUCA COCHA LAGOON
After breakfast, we’ll ascend to Arapa Pass (4,850 m / 15,912 ft) for stunning views of alpine landscapes and turquoise lagoons. We’ll then descend to Puca Cocha Lagoon, located at the foot of Ausangate, where we’ll camp surrounded by spectacular scenery.
DAY 3: PUCA COCHA LAGOON – PALOMANI PASS – PAMPA JANCA
Today we’ll hike up to Palomani Pass (5,200 m / 17,060 ft), the highest point of the trek, offering panoramic views of glaciers and deep valleys. We’ll descend to Pampa Janca for dinner and our final night camping.
DAY 4: PAMPA JANCA – RAINBOW MOUNTAIN – CUSCO
We’ll start early to reach the famous Rainbow Mountain (Vinicunca), arriving before the crowds to fully enjoy the stunning view. Afterward, we’ll descend to Chillihuani village to take our private transport back to Cusco, arriving around 6:00 p.m.
